AEO, or Answer Engine Optimization, is the practice of optimizing content and brand signals so AI answer engines surface and recommend you in their responses. Where SEO targets a ranked list of links, AEO targets being the answer itself.
Citation rate is how frequently AI engines cite a brand or its website as a source when answering questions in its category. A high citation rate means the engine repeatedly leans on your content to ground its answers.
AI visibility is how often and how prominently a brand appears in the answers generated by AI engines like ChatGPT, Gemini, Claude, and Perplexity. A brand with high AI visibility is named, cited, and recommended when people ask AI for options in its category.
Grounding is when an AI engine bases its answer on retrieved, real-world sources rather than relying only on its trained memory. Grounded answers cite the pages the model pulled from, often via live web search.
